First Ever Dive Festival Coming in June

The Green Monkey Dive Shop with the support of the Montserrat Tourist
Board (MTB) and the Montserrat Tourism Challenge Fund (MTCF) will host
the destination’s inaugural Montserrat Dive Festival from June 27 – July
4, 2009. Held in conjunction with Montserrat’s bi-annual Reef Check
Program, the scheduled dive program includes a free Coral Reef
Conservation Specialty course, discounted Peak Performance Buoyancy
course and two tank dive trip to the elusive Redonda Island. The
Montserrat Dive Festival will also offer activities for adults, children
and non-divers including scenic boat tours to Plymouth, land tours and
kayaking trips.  Dive festival registration is $25 USD and includes a
2009 Montserrat Dive Festival & Reef Check T-shirt, welcome cocktail
reception, reef check classroom instruction and reef check dives
including tanks and weights (buoyancy control device and regulator
additional), PADI/Project AWARE Coral Reef Conservation Specialty course
(certificate card additional), BBQ and Beach Party, and 20 – 30%
discount on all dives and scheduled activities. For more information,

ZDF TV From Germany Visits Montserrat
During the period May 7-12th, 2009, a four man crew from ZDF TV in
Germany visited Montserrat, to film a documentary on the island. ZDF is
Europe’s largest television station and the documentary on Montserrat
will air during the 2009 Christmas period to an estimated audience of 5
million viewers.  Mr. Juergen Podzkiewitz, a producer with ZDF TV in
Germany, visited Montserrat earlier this year on a scouting mission.
His visit convinced him that Montserrat had a tourism product offer that
was unique enough to warrant the production of a documentary.

Montserrat Featured in Lonely Planet Magazine
Montserrat is featured in  an 11-page spread in the June 2009 print
edition of the Lonely Planet Magazine UK.  The piece was written by UK
comedian and journalist John O’Farrell who visited Montserrat during the
2009 St. Patrick’s Week celebrations.  The link below provides a
